On the dev side, there’s buzz around Kaspa smart contracts and the upcoming Kasia update (v0.4.0). Group chat and better moderation tools are on the roadmap, and it sounds like devs are gearing up for more app integrations. Plus, there’s talk of an oracle framework in the works — though it’s still early days.
